Apeejay School, Faridabad, established in July 1972 was first of its kind in the state of Haryana. It has two wings, the primary wing being located in Sector 14 and the senior wing in Sector 15 Faridabad. [1]
The school is affiliated to the Central Board of Secondary Education for its All India Secondary School Examination and Senior secondary education and is also a member of the National Progressive Schools Conference. At the +2 level, the school offers all the three streams viz. Science, Commerce and Humanities.
Senior Wing
The senior wing functions from a sprawling 8 acre campus located in the heart of Sector 15, Faridabad. The academic block is built on three levels and includes two computer laboratories, an LCD room, multiple science laboratories and different halls for fine arts, music and dance. Various amenities are provided for physical excursions, including multiple fields for football, hockey and cricket along with separate courts for volleyball, badminton and basketball.
The school also has Swimming pool which hosts various district level swimming championships. Twin auditoriums dot the campus, being used for a variety of seminars and conferences. The primary library is spacious and contains over 18000 books and 40 periodicals.
Primary Wing
The primary wing functions from its own modular campus in Sector 14, Faridabad. The campus contains a small splash pool, a large field for sports and courts for volleyball. Different laboratories exist for science and computers along with an LCD room. A library housing a large collection of fiction is also present. An auditorium is built for interactive sessions as well as regular and meaningful assemblies.

Apeejay Education Society (APJ), established in India in 1967 by Dr. Stya Paul, is a private educational society. It consists of 14 Schools and 13 Institutions of higher learning imparting education in India. Ms Sushma Paul Berlia, the only child of Dr. Stya Paul, and one of India most renowned entrepreneurs and educationists is the Chairperson. All the Apeejay schools are members of the National Progressive Schools Conference (NPSC) and are affiliated to the Central Board of Secondary Education(CBSE). It has been accredited to the British Council for London Examination Qualifications . In 2010, Apeejay Education Society started Apeejay Stya University in collaboration with the Apeejay Education Society in Gurgaon, Haryana.
